Overview

PTx809 is a preclinical-stage small molecule therapeutic being developed by Primal Therapies for daily oral care. It utilizes the company's proprietary SMMRT (Selective Microbial Metabolism Regulation Technology) platform, which is designed to selectively regulate oral microbial metabolism rather than non-selectively eliminating bacteria. PTx809 is characterized as a prebiotic, postbiotic, and antimicrobial agent that aims to maintain a healthy oral microbiome. The asset is currently in formulation development as a powder intended for out-licensing to commercial partners.
